Recognizing Low-VOC Paints
When you choose low-VOC paints, you're opting for a product that produces fewer unpredictable natural compounds, which can be hazardous to both your health and the environment.
VOCs are chemicals discovered in several paint products that can evaporate into the air and add to indoor air pollution. By picking low-VOC alternatives, you're decreasing the number of these exhausts, making your space more secure.
Low-VOC paints generally include 50 grams per litre or less VOCs, compared to standard paints that can contain as much as 250 grams per litre. This implies that when you paint your home with low-VOC items, you're not simply choosing for visual appeals; you're likewise taking a step towards a much healthier indoor setting.

Prospective Disadvantages to Think About
While low-VOC paints offer countless benefits, there are some prospective downsides to keep in mind. One significant worry is their efficiency compared to traditional paints. Low-VOC choices might not always supply the very same level of resilience and insurance coverage, which can result in even more frequent touch-ups or a demand for added coats. This can be irritating and time-consuming during your painting task.
An additional concern is the drying out time. Low-VOC paints commonly take longer to completely dry than their high-VOC counterparts, which can extend your task timeline. If you're on a tight timetable, this may be a drawback to take into consideration.
